Summary
Photograph. Mr. Gordon Craig (1872 - 1966) in "The Dead Heart" by Watts Phillips (1825-1874) standing sideways
Provenance
Photographs collected by a Miss Muston one-time hairdresser to Ellen Terry and donated to Smallhythe Place by Mr.Wayne Gould.
Marks and inscriptions
Front, on photograph centre: Miss Muston from Gordon Craig = / 1889. Front, below photograph centre: MR. GORDON CRAIG IN "THE DEAD HEART." / WINDOW & GROVE 63A BAKER STREET, W. Back, centre: WINDOW & GROVE. / PHOTOGRAPHER TO THE ROYAL FAMILY. / 63A BAKER ST. PORTMAN SQUARE, / LONDON. W. / THE NEGATIVE OF THIS PHOTOGRAPH IS PRESERVED / FROM WHICH ENLARGEMENTS OR FURTHER COPIES / CAN ALWAYS BE OBTAINED.
